summ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Robert Buchholz <rbu@gentoo.org>2007-09-17 22:20:04 +0000
committerRobert Buchholz <rbu@gentoo.org>2007-09-17 22:20:04 +0000
commitc5ceed71907832a201fe9fccca3a79f5c200dd1e (patch)
tree33376d200864ded700a229bff9b9ac84df44385e /media-libs/libspiff
parentStable on ppc; bug #183151. (diff)
downloadgentoo-2-c5ceed71907832a201fe9fccca3a79f5c200dd1e.tar.gz
gentoo-2-c5ceed71907832a201fe9fccca3a79f5c200dd1e.tar.bz2
gentoo-2-c5ceed71907832a201fe9fccca3a79f5c200dd1e.zip
Version bump: Bugfixes and less memleaks. Change of SONAME.
(Portage version: 2.1.3.9)
Diffstat (limited to 'media-libs/libspiff')
-rw-r--r--media-libs/libspiff/ChangeLog9
-rw-r--r--media-libs/libspiff/files/digest-libspiff-0.5.23
-rw-r--r--media-libs/libspiff/files/digest-libspiff-0.6.33
-rw-r--r--media-libs/libspiff/files/digest-libspiff-0.8.03
-rw-r--r--media-libs/libspiff/libspiff-0.5.2.ebuild35
-rw-r--r--media-libs/libspiff/libspiff-0.8.0.ebuild (renamed from media-libs/libspiff/libspiff-0.6.3.ebuild)8
6 files changed, 17 insertions, 44 deletions
diff --git a/media-libs/libspiff/ChangeLog b/media-libs/libspiff/ChangeLog
index 23edeb9a4465..acd22780d6f8 100644
--- a/media-libs/libspiff/ChangeLog
+++ b/media-libs/libspiff/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for media-libs/libspiff
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libspiff/ChangeLog,v 1.10 2007/08/09 23:39:34 rbu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libspiff/ChangeLog,v 1.11 2007/09/17 22:20:03 rbu Exp $
+
+*libspiff-0.8.0 (17 Sep 2007)
+
+ 17 Sep 2007; Robert Buchholz <rbu@gentoo.org> -libspiff-0.5.2.ebuild,
+ -libspiff-0.6.3.ebuild, +libspiff-0.8.0.ebuild:
+ Version bump: Bugfixes and less memleaks. Change of SONAME, please recompile
+ applications. Also tidied up old versions.
*libspiff-0.7.2 (09 Aug 2007)
diff --git a/media-libs/libspiff/files/digest-libspiff-0.5.2 b/media-libs/libspiff/files/digest-libspiff-0.5.2
deleted file mode 100644
index 1aa25dcceaa2..000000000000
--- a/media-libs/libspiff/files/digest-libspiff-0.5.2
+++ /dev/null
@@ -1,3 +0,0 @@
-MD5 c15deb9df29f2cac104a3a6864149596 libspiff-0.5.2.tar.bz2 194102
-RMD160 794b71720c38d005d28a828ed8f1c78bd4d53fcf libspiff-0.5.2.tar.bz2 194102
-SHA256 fd27fa452fc36f9b3fa6610f4c9241b82325f830dba2fbe2ac6ec2bd21d5294d libspiff-0.5.2.tar.bz2 194102
diff --git a/media-libs/libspiff/files/digest-libspiff-0.6.3 b/media-libs/libspiff/files/digest-libspiff-0.6.3
deleted file mode 100644
index 927b48684355..000000000000
--- a/media-libs/libspiff/files/digest-libspiff-0.6.3
+++ /dev/null
@@ -1,3 +0,0 @@
-MD5 682a628137caa33e8083946e21fa9f94 libspiff-0.6.3.tar.bz2 456661
-RMD160 a5b5c99ea52d91135478db661db58509bbf2ba14 libspiff-0.6.3.tar.bz2 456661
-SHA256 88ab5575cf426f5b1e798548fe487221a267aad8265498c39d89eec1e311f7dc libspiff-0.6.3.tar.bz2 456661
diff --git a/media-libs/libspiff/files/digest-libspiff-0.8.0 b/media-libs/libspiff/files/digest-libspiff-0.8.0
new file mode 100644
index 000000000000..b6bd72b0cc72
--- /dev/null
+++ b/media-libs/libspiff/files/digest-libspiff-0.8.0
@@ -0,0 +1,3 @@
+MD5 9ae5920d6a0cb7e0873c47815dc892fe libspiff-0.8.0.tar.bz2 502877
+RMD160 fcfac1f2263c5aa416696ca7c1b41c1922fe3f29 libspiff-0.8.0.tar.bz2 502877
+SHA256 81b1cf8ff8d3dd1f8c0b7390ead86192b3439875ce1516d6f786f955878f3a34 libspiff-0.8.0.tar.bz2 502877
diff --git a/media-libs/libspiff/libspiff-0.5.2.ebuild b/media-libs/libspiff/libspiff-0.5.2.ebuild
deleted file mode 100644
index 8da2b20b62b9..000000000000
--- a/media-libs/libspiff/libspiff-0.5.2.ebuild
+++ /dev/null
@@ -1,35 +0,0 @@
-# Copyright 1999-2007 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libspiff/libspiff-0.5.2.ebuild,v 1.1 2007/01/04 03:08:07 beandog Exp $
-
-DESCRIPTION="Library for XSPF playlist reading and writing"
-HOMEPAGE="http://libspiff.sourceforge.net/"
-S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"
-LICENSE="LGPL-2.1"
-SLOT="0"
-KEYWORDS="~amd64 ~x86"
-IUSE="doc"
-RDEPEND=">=dev-libs/expat-1.95.8"
-DEPEND="${RDEPEND}
- doc? ( app-doc/doxygen )"
-
-src_compile() {
- econf || die "configure failed"
- emake || die "emake failed"
-
- if use doc; then
- ebegin "Creating documentation"
- cd "${S}/doc"
- doxygen Doxyfile
- eend 0
- fi
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die "make install failed"
- dodoc README AUTHORS ChangeLog
-
- if use doc; then
- dohtml doc/html/*
- fi
-}
diff --git a/media-libs/libspiff/libspiff-0.6.3.ebuild b/media-libs/libspiff/libspiff-0.8.0.ebuild
index 9b7a299968d7..00ccb2f88b9b 100644
--- a/media-libs/libspiff/libspiff-0.6.3.ebuild
+++ b/media-libs/libspiff/libspiff-0.8.0.ebuild
@@ -1,13 +1,13 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libspiff/libspiff-0.6.3.ebuild,v 1.1 2007/04/13 01:25:14 beandog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libspiff/libspiff-0.8.0.ebuild,v 1.1 2007/09/17 22:20:03 rbu Exp $
DESCRIPTION="Library for XSPF playlist reading and writing"
HOMEPAGE="http://libspiff.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"
LICENSE="LGPL-2.1 BSD"
SLOT="0"
-KEYWORDS="~amd64 ~x86"
+KEYWORDS="~amd64 ~sparc ~x86 ~ppc"
IUSE="doc"
RDEPEND=">=dev-libs/expat-1.95.8"
DEPEND="${RDEPEND}
@@ -34,3 +34,7 @@ src_install() {
dohtml doc/html/*
fi
}
+
+pkg_postinst() {
+ einfo "libspiff-0.8.0 changed its SONAME. Please run # revdep-rebuild to recompile your XSPF applications."
+}